Who Can Opt For Surrogacy In India?

Surrogacy in India has undergone a significant transformation with the enactment of the Surrogacy (Regulation) Act, 2021, which permits only altruistic surrogacy and bans commercial surrogacy. If you're considering surrogacy as a path to parenthood, it's crucial to understand who is eligible to opt for surrogacy under the new law.

What Is Altruistic Surrogacy?
Altruistic surrogacy involves a woman volunteering to carry a child for the intending couple without receiving any monetary compensation, except for medical expenses and insurance. The focus is on ethical family-building, eliminating commercial incentives and protecting the rights of all parties involved.

Who Is Eligible to Opt for Surrogacy in India?
According to the Surrogacy (Regulation) Act, only specific categories of people can opt for surrogacy:

1. Married Indian Couples (Infertile)
• Must be legally married for at least 5 years.
• The female partner should be between 23–50 ...
... years, and the male partner between 26–55 years.
• The couple must be medically proven infertile or unable to conceive after medical attempts.
• They must not have any biological, adopted, or surrogate child (unless the child has a life-threatening disorder or is physically/mentally challenged).

2. Intending Woman (Single, Widow, or Divorcee)
• Must be an Indian citizen, aged between 35–45 years.
• Must not have any surviving biological, adopted, or surrogate child.
• Must provide a medical certificate of infertility or health condition justifying surrogacy as a necessity.

Who Cannot Opt for Surrogacy in India?
Under the current law, the following are not allowed to pursue surrogacy:
• Foreign nationals or NRIs.
• Live-in partners.
• Same-sex couples.
• Married couples with existing children (unless medically justified).
• Couples seeking commercial surrogacy.

Who Can Be a Surrogate Mother?
A surrogate must:
• Be a married Indian woman aged 25–35 years.
• Have at least one biological child of her own.
• Be medically and psychologically fit.
• Have no more than one surrogacy in her lifetime.
• Be a close relative (as per law) of the intending couple or woman.

Conclusion
India’s new altruistic surrogacy framework focuses on ethical, need-based surrogacy, prioritizing the well-being of surrogate mothers and intended parents.
